A Symphony of Gears and Dreams: The Artistry of Paul Virgile Mathez-Rossel
Paul Virgile Mathez-Rossel, a name perhaps less familiar to the general art world than many of his contemporaries, represents a profoundly unique intersection of engineering, design, and artistic expression. Born in 1919 in Tramelan, Switzerland – a village steeped in watchmaking tradition – Mathez-Rossel’s life unfolded not merely as that of a craftsman, but as a deliberate orchestration of intricate mechanical art. His legacy isn't found in grand museums or sprawling exhibitions, but rather within the delicate dance of gears and springs housed within his meticulously crafted watches, each piece a miniature testament to his singular vision. Initially, he established PVM SA, the watch manufacturing company based in Tramelan, Switzerland, which is the manufacturer of the Sabina brand of watches.The Watchmaker’s Genesis: A Family Tradition and Early Influences
Mathez-Rossel's artistic journey was inextricably linked to his family history. The village of Tramelan has long been a crucible for watchmaking excellence, passed down through generations. His father, Virgile Mathez, was himself a renowned master watchmaker, instilling in Paul not just the technical skills but also an appreciation for the precision and beauty inherent in horological mechanics. This early immersion fostered a deep respect for the craft, a reverence that would later inform his artistic approach. While he didn’t formally study art, Mathez-Rossel's eye for detail, honed through years of working with incredibly small components, undoubtedly shaped his aesthetic sensibilities. The influence of Swiss watchmaking tradition—its emphasis on accuracy, functionality, and understated elegance—is undeniably present in his work, yet he transcends mere replication, imbuing each timepiece with a distinctly personal narrative.Mechanical Art: A Fusion of Engineering and Poetic Design

Technique and Innovation: The Soul of a Master Craftsman
The technical mastery displayed by Mathez-Rossel is truly remarkable. He was known for his incredibly small movements, often requiring him to work with components measured in fractions of a millimeter. His dedication to precision is evident in every detail, from the hand-finished bridges and plates to the flawlessly polished gears. While he embraced traditional techniques – hand engraving, guilloché (a decorative pattern created by milling), and intricate gold chasing – he was also willing to experiment with innovative approaches, pushing the boundaries of what was considered possible within the world of fine watchmaking. He developed unique tools and methods to achieve his ambitious designs, demonstrating a relentless pursuit of perfection.Legacy and Significance: A Timeless Expression
